Idaho agencies leverage Access Idaho to modernize websites and
improve accessibility

BOISE, Idaho -- (Business Wire)
The administrator of Idaho’s official Web portal (Idaho.gov)
and provider of electronic government solutions for the state, Access
Idaho, is working with agency webmasters, at no cost, to update their
websites by providing customizable templates and tools compatible with
mobile devices.
Two of the first state entities that leveraged Access Idaho’s WordPress
toolkit have launched sites this year: the Idaho Bureau of Homeland
Security and the STEM (Science Technology Engineering and Math) Action
Center.
One of the state’s biggest agencies, the Idaho
Transportation Department, is in the process of revamping its
website with the help of Access Idaho’s expertise.
“Access Idaho helped us go from no website to an attractive,
mobile-friendly one in less than a month,” said Angela Hemingway, Idaho
STEM Action Center Executive Director. “And the steps to update our site
are extraordinarily quick and easy.”
About 58 percent of Idaho citizens are using mobile devices as their
primary or only access to the Internet. Because of this, agencies are
increasingly needing to provide mobile-friendly access. The Idaho
Office of the CIO is encouraging state agencies to take advantage of
Access Idaho’s templates and development resources.
The partnership between state agencies and Access Idaho operates under a
self-funded model, in which no tax dollars were used to develop and none
are necessary to maintain services.
About Access Idaho
Access Idaho is the administrator of Idaho’s official Web portal (Idaho.gov)
and provider of electronic government solutions for the state. The
network manager for the portal is Idaho Information Consortium, a
subsidiary of eGovernment firm NIC (Nasdaq: EGOV).
